Imagination Theater will present Father of the Bride, directed by Peter Wolfe, opening on September 9.

This is a story familiar to many about a doting father who faces mountains of bills and endless trials when his daughter marries. The play, based on the novel by Edward Streeter, was also the basis for the 1950 film with Spencer Tracy and Elizabeth Taylor.
